Letter from Pádraig Ó Deaneám, secretary of the Gaelic League (Kinnegad branch) to Éamonn Ceannt inviting him to a Gaelic League event,
1906 April 24.
Pádraig Ó Deaneám at Coralstown National School, Killucan, Co. Westmeath describes an upcoming League event, to be held on 10 June, in which they are "catering in a very lavish manner for the amusement of the clients". After conversation with James Marten, he was "empowered to write to [Ceannt], extending a cordial invitation" to Cumann na bPíobairí members and asking what remuneration they can provide for their services.
